Output ec27e50692870970f8ad8c851ea26136f2b9e4d1fe62d9ff069175b4e4e3265f:1

value
33913300515
script pubkey
OP_0 OP_PUSHBYTES_20 69431782e52977f0d4e76a6d64ecfeb6623a4b6e
address
ltc1qd9p30qh999mlp488dfkkfm87ke3r5jmwuew4e0
transaction
ec27e50692870970f8ad8c851ea26136f2b9e4d1fe62d9ff069175b4e4e3265f
spent
true